Experience the true Santo Domingo on this immersive tour through its most authentic neighborhoods.

We start at the Eduardo Brito Metro Station, where your urban adventure begins with a warm Dominican coffee and a welcome from local residents. Explore vibrant markets, traditional beauty salons, and corner stores (“colmados”) as you dive into everyday Dominican life.

You’ll visit a typical neighborhood home and savor a “helado de fundita” along with a traditional breakfast or lunch (empanadas or chimi, depending on schedule). The tour continues aboard the Santo Domingo cable car, offering spectacular views of the northern barrios, followed by a metro ride that connects you to the city from a different perspective.

We’ll also stop by a renowned dembow music studio, a baseball field, a soccer pitch, and much more—an urban experience rich in culture and flavor.
